Today, Lamin Waa Juwara, was taken away from his compound by six individuals
claiming to be from the NIA.  This was after a press conference where Juwara
challenged the position of Yaya Jammeh on the Nawetaan ban as well as the
state of the nation.

He had received a call asking him to report to the NIA during the press
conference.  Because he could not go at the time, 2 cars with six
individuals paid him a visit.  Juwara asked for an arrest warrant or
identification, neither of which was proffered.  A push and pull situation
arose and to avoid it's escalation, he agreed to go with them.  We do not
know where he is at this time.  We will keep you posted as we work to get
him back to his family and to the work at hand - rescuing The Gambia.
